You Can Heal Your Lifeby Louise Hay
I think this book may be a tough pill to swallow for some.
“Thoughts do create things” is pretty much the fundamental premise of this book. And the author delves into the idea so much so that she created a chart that lays out various illnesses and their corresponding thought patterns.
As a hands on healer I see these thought patterns manifesting into illness all the time. Through chat therapy a recurring thought or self-belief usually emerges.
This book, if you’re open to it’s philosophies and premise will change your life. Not only change it but give you tools to transform it easily.

What The Bleep Do We Know!?by William Arntz, Betsy Chasse and Mark Vicente
I saw What the Bleep in theatres and loved it. I walked out of the darkness and emerged into the dawning of a new paradigm shift.
So when I discover that the creators of the movie had put out a book I bought it right away.
And after reading the book I have to say that I think it’s better than the movie.
This book is like the science book you wish you read in high-school. Imagine how different your life would be if that was the case.
Here’s a quote from the book:
“The bottom line, at least as far as science has gone up till now, is this: We create the world we perceive. When I open my eyes and look around, it is not ‘the world’ that I see, but the world my human sensory equipment is able to see, the world my belief system allows me to see, and the world that my emotions care about seeing or not seeing.”
I know a lot of hardcore science people say that this type of stuff is fluff or pseudo-science. And I can understand that. But the key I think is to realize that this type of pseudo-fluff-science has inspired and will continue to inspire millions of people to have the courage to change their lives.

Rich Dad Poor Dad by Robert KiyosakiI’ve have purchased and given away this book more times than I can remember.
I even went to go check out this book on my book shelf and realized that it’s currently out “on loan”.
Which means I’ll never see it again so it’s time to buy myself another copy.
And even though there may be some controversy around Mr. Kiyosaki I still recommend this book.
For anyone that’s looking for inspiration to get them out of the rat race then this book is for you.
It helped me to realize that if I don’t show up to work then I don’t get paid, and this is a bad place t be financially.
Instead it would better for me financially to create and invest in cash-flow producing assets.
I know it sounds boring but it’s not.
